Relay Graduate School of Education (Relay) is an accredited not-for-profit institution of higher education serving thousands of educators from across the country, from pre-service teachers to system-level leaders. Our mission is to ensure that all students are taught by excellent educators, in order to build a more just world where every student has a clear path to a fulfilling life.
The Managing Director, Admissions & Enrollment will work to ensure that Relay is able to effectively scale its programs and partnerships to reach thousands of educators across the country. The Managing Director will lead cross-team collaboration and set the vision for central systems and processes to effectively meet or exceed annual revenue and enrollment targets year over year. This will require setting the vision and direction for a data-driven approach to enrollment management that builds on the strengths of Relay’s efforts to date and further centralizes its approach to be more replicable and efficient, particularly as the institution expands its program offerings to reach new audiences and maximize impact.
Reporting to the Vice President, Partnerships & Enrollment, this candidate is an exceptional people manager and excels in developing and strengthening replicable, efficient systems and processes that reduce friction for partners and applicants. The Managing Director will manage two sub-teams: Prospective Student Advising and Admissions & Enrollment. Further, they will work closely across many teams within the institution, including Partnerships, Regulatory & Accreditation, Technology, and Marketing & Communications.
